iHeartMedia has appointed Ann Marie Licata as CEO of the company’s multiplatform group, which is iHeart’s largest operating segment. The other two operating segments will continue to be led by current CEOs Donal Byrne (digital audio group) and Mark Gray (audio and media services group).
The multiplatform group includes the iHeartMedia markets group, which operates the company’s more than 860 local broadcast radio stations; iHeart live events and sponsorship; the radio networks businesses, including Premiere and TTWN; the enterprise business development group; and data targeting and attribution products for broadcast radio. Licata previously served as president of the markets group & sales operations at iHeart. Julie Donohue, president of the enterprise development group, and Julie Talbott, president of Premiere Networks, will report to Licata under the new configuration.
In addition to Licata, Bernie Weiss was promoted to president of the markets group. He will oversee the operations of iHeart’s 160 markets. He was previously COO of the markets group.
“We couldn’t be more pleased that Ann Marie will be leading the growth and innovation efforts for our company’s largest segment,” said Bob Pittman, chairman and CEO of iHeartMedia, in a statement. “In addition to helping businesses and brands grow effectively and efficiently, the Multiplatform Group has been an important engine to develop our own important new businesses — including podcasting and the iHeartRadio digital service — as well as our iconic live music events and awards shows. We look forward to the additional growth that will come as we move broadcast radio into the digital buying world through our data services and programmatic platforms.”
“We have a diversified business at iHeart, with our Multiplatform Group, the Digital Audio Group and the Audio and Media Services Group, and we’re very pleased that Ann Marie has taken on the responsibility for the Multiplatform Group at such an important time for the company,” added Rich Bressler, president and COO of iHeartMedia. — Chris Eggertsen
